Yorkshire vs Gloucestershire
Gloucestershire were at 204/6 at start of Day 3's play. However, they could add only 29 runs before getting dismissed and setting a target of 241 runs.
In response to the chase, Yorkshire got support from Adam Lyth (49) and George Hill (36). But, the middle-order could not respond well leading to a collapse for the team. In the end, Dom Bess remained unbeaten on 79 off 103 balls, while Yorkshire was all-out for a total of 202 runs, and fell short of 18 runs.
Zafar Gohar and David Payne scalped four wickets each for the Gloucs.
